The Dan Wesson is twice the price but, honestly, twice the gun. DW are at the top of the pile for production 1911s. They are small low production shop with an almost semi-custom shop attention to detail. To do any better than a DW you need to go to the true semi-customs like Les Baer, Nighthawk and Wilson Combat.
Now are you looking at a Guardian in .45 or 9mm? The Guardian has an aluminum frame so you want to take that into consideration when you purchase. There will definitely be a bit more felt recoil with the Guardian than a steel framed commander like the V-Bob.
